Worship at Christ Church
A Feast for the Soul, the Ear, the Eye, the Heart, the Mind

Each week is a feast for the soul, engaging body, mind and spirit as we gather to hear God's Word and receive the Holy Communion. Visitors are always welcome, and because the entire service is printed each week in a user friendly bulletin, you need not be concerned about finding your way in hymnals and prayer books.

Formal Worship on Sundays at 8:30 and 11:00 a.m. combine the best in the historic liturgy of the church with inspiring music offered to God by our choir, soloists and director of music.

For those wishing an informal and casual worship experience come to our Contemporary Service each Sunday at 8:45 a.m. Worship is lead by our praise band and choir. Children's sermons are given and children are made to feel especially welcome in this forty-five minute service.
